Scott names his race team HScott Motorsports

SPARTANBURG, S.C. (AP) -- Harry Scott Jr. is rebranding the race team he bought from James Finch last season into HScott Motorsports.
The team was previously called Phoenix Racing under Finch's ownership.
Scott bought the team in October from Finch and will field one full-time car for Justin Allgaier this season. Bobby Labonte will attempt to make the Daytona 500 in a car that has a partnership with Finch.
The rebranding includes an updated digital platform to include a website, Facebook page, Twitter and Instagram accounts.
